The Last Five Years by Jason Robert Brown is an emotionally powerful and intimate musical about two New Yorkers in their twenties who fall in and out of love over the course of five years. The show's unconventional structure consists of Cathy telling her story backwards while Jamie's story is told chronologically; the two characters only meet once, at their wedding in the middle of the show.
